Streamlining Security Certificate Updates with Automation and AI
aka Ending The Expiry Date Nightmare
In today's digital age, ensuring secure communication between servers is of utmost importance for businesses to safeguard their sensitive data. One of the critical components in establishing secure communication is the use of IT security certificates. These certificates act as digital credentials that validate the identity of the communicating parties and establish trust between them.
However, managing these certificates can be a daunting task for IT teams, especially when they have to deal with large-scale infrastructures. Manually updating security certificates across multiple servers can be a time-consuming and error-prone process, which can lead to lapses in security and system downtime. In this post, we will discuss how automation and AI can help streamline the process of updating security certificates between servers.
The Current Process of Updating Security Certificates
Before we delve into the benefits of using automation and AI, let us first understand the current process of updating security certificates. Typically, IT teams have to manually check the expiration dates of their security certificates and then update them accordingly. This involves identifying the certificates that are nearing expiration, generating new certificates, and installing them on the appropriate servers.
The process of manual updating of certificates is laborious and can be prone to human error. For instance, an IT team may miss an upcoming certificate expiration, which can lead to communication breakdowns between servers. Additionally, generating new certificates and installing them on servers can be time-consuming and can result in system downtime.
Introducing Automation and AI
Automation and AI can help streamline the process of updating security certificates between servers by removing the need for manual intervention. AI can be used to identify upcoming certificate expiries and generate new certificates automatically. Automation can then be used to install these new certificates on the appropriate servers.
A Theoretical Application of Automation and AI
Let us consider a theoretical application of automation and AI in updating security certificates. In this scenario, an AI algorithm continuously monitors the expiration dates of security certificates across all servers. The algorithm then generates new certificates and installs them automatically on the appropriate servers.
To achieve this, the AI algorithm would need access to all security certificates across the infrastructure and their respective expiration dates. It would also need to be integrated with the infrastructure's certificate management system. Bearing in mind that many companies already use a central program to manage the certificates in their environment, we can easily say that the inherent risk of the eggs-in-one-basket approach has already been acknowledged, understood, and accepted.
Automation and AI Technologies
Several automation and AI technologies can be used to implement the theoretical application discussed above. For instance, machine learning algorithms can be trained on historical certificate data to predict future expirations accurately. Robotic process automation (RPA) can then be used to install the new certificates automatically.
RPA involves the use of software robots that can mimic human actions to automate repetitive and rule-based tasks. These robots can be programmed to install new certificates on servers automatically. Additionally, RPA can be integrated with machine learning algorithms to enable more intelligent decision-making.
Using automation and AI to update security certificates between servers offers several benefits to businesses. First, it can help increase efficiency by removing the need for manual intervention. AI algorithms can continuously monitor certificate expirations, generate new certificates, and install them automatically, saving IT teams a significant amount of time and effort.
Second, using automation and AI can reduce errors in the certificate update process. AI algorithms can accurately predict upcoming certificate expirations, reducing the risk of communication breakdowns between servers. Additionally, RPA can install new certificates accurately and consistently, minimizing the risk of installation errors.
Potential Risks of Using Automation and AI
While using automation and AI can offer several benefits, it is not without risks. One of the most significant risks is data privacy concerns. AI algorithms would require access to sensitive information, such as certificate details and expiration dates, which could potentially be accessed by malicious actors if not properly secured. To mitigate this risk, businesses should ensure that the AI algorithms are only accessible to authorised personnel and implement proper encryption and access control measures.
Another risk is potential system failures. If the automation and AI systems are not properly implemented or maintained, they could lead to system downtime or even data loss. To mitigate this risk, businesses should thoroughly test and monitor the automation and AI systems to ensure they are working as intended.
Recommendations for Mitigating Risks
To mitigate the risks associated with using automation and AI in updating security certificates, businesses should follow the below recommendations:
Secure the AI algorithms and automation systems: Businesses should ensure that the AI algorithms and automation systems are only accessible to authorized personnel and implement proper encryption and access control measures.
Thoroughly test the automation and AI systems: Before deploying automation and AI systems, businesses should thoroughly test them to ensure they are working as intended. This includes testing for potential system failures and errors.
Continuously monitor the automation and AI systems: Businesses should continuously monitor the automation and AI systems to ensure they are working as intended and detect any potential issues early on.
Conclusion
In conclusion, updating security certificates between servers can be a daunting task for IT teams, especially when dealing with large-scale infrastructures. The use of automation and AI can help simplify this process by removing the need for manual intervention. Automation and AI technologies, such as machine learning algorithms and RPA, can be used to identify upcoming certificate expiries and install new certificates automatically.
While using automation and AI offers several benefits, businesses should be aware of the potential risks associated with these technologies, such as data privacy concerns and system failures. By implementing proper security measures and testing and monitoring the automation and AI systems, businesses can mitigate these risks and enjoy the benefits of a streamlined certificate update process.

